The Glimmer of Light in the Old Factory—Quanzhou Yuanhe 1916 Creative Industrial Park

The red brick exterior retains the roughness of time, while steel beams and skylights reveal the industrial bones. At Yuanhe 1916, the aroma of coffee, printing ink, and wood sawdust blend into a new urban scent. The studio's doors are wide open, and the sea breeze gently undulates the edges of the canvases. The bookstore displays the fonts of old newspapers and the texture of new books, and the design exhibition fuses waste materials with inspiration into usable objects.

Sitting on a bench in the courtyard, I watch the dusk paint the brick walls a rosy hue. This place teaches people to respect "regeneration": it's not about demolishing the old and building the new, but about negotiating with the old, finding new uses and emotional connections. As the lights come on, the factory buildings, like awakened beasts, are quiet yet powerful. Before leaving, I bought a handmade print, its edges endearingly rough. I knew I wasn't taking away a souvenir, but an attitude—keeping memories alive, allowing the city to grow gently.
